Solutions for Keeping Food Warm
1. Heated Serving Stations:
Heated serving stations keep food at optimal temperatures until served. These stations can be strategically placed around the venue for easy access.
2. Insulated Containers:
Insulated containers transport and serve hot dishes. These containers help retain heat during transit and ensure that food remains warm when it reaches guests.
3. Timing Meals to Perfection:
Careful meal timing. Dishes are scheduled to be served shortly after being prepared, minimizing the time they spend outside heating sources.

How Professional Caterers Plan Preparation Strategies
1. Backup Plans for Outdoor Events:
Contingency plans for outdoor events could include renting tents or marquees to protect guests and food from unexpected weather changes.
2. Weather-Resistant Setups:
Weather-resistant equipment and materials for catering setup may include sturdy tables and coverings that can withstand wind and moisture.
3. Proactive Coordination with the Venue:
Close communication with the venue regarding weather forecasts leading to the event allows for timely adjustments and preparations based on anticipated conditions.

Enhancing Guest Comfort with Seasonal Catering Touches
Creating a warm and inviting dining experience is welcomed during winter events.
Adding Warmth to the Dining Experience
1. Live-Action Stations: Consider incorporating live-action cooking stations where chefs prepare dishes on-site, providing warmth and entertainment for guests.
2. Hot Beverage Bars: Set up hot beverage bars featuring options like mulled wine, hot chocolate, or spiced cider to keep guests warm and cozy throughout the event.
3. Comfort Food Buffets: Offer comfort food options that resonate with winter themes—think hearty stews, roasted vegetables, and warm bread rolls that provide a sense of homely warmth.
Thoughtful Catering Touches
Small touches can make a big impact on guest satisfaction during winter events. Consider providing blankets or shawls for guests who may feel chilly while dining outdoors or opt for decorative heaters around seating areas to enhance comfort levels.
